Panasonic, Sochi reach agreement

Panasonic extended its Olympic sponsorship to the Sochi 2014 Olympics, adding the household appliances category for the upcoming Games.

Panasonic will provide as many as 5,000 household appliances for the Olympics.

Dmitry Chernyshenko President and CEO of Sochi 2014 called Panasonic a "perfect fit" for the Games.

Panasonic, already is a TOP Sponsor, having the audio-visual category for its IOC sponsorship.

USA Wrestling Adds partner

USA Wrestling and Dick’s sporting goods announced a partnership for the "Keep Wrestling 2020 Vision Campaign."

Dicks will lend support with social media campaigns, website promotion, as well as in-store promotions.

"DICK’S Sporting Goods recognizes the dedication and values wrestling instils in young athletes and is proud to partner with USA Wrestling to support these elite competitors’dream to represent their country in the Olympics," said Lauren Hobart, DICK’S Sporting Goods Chief Marketing Officer.

"We encourage wrestling supporters to sign the petition to make their voices heard."

Glasgow 2014 events partner

Great Big Events will deliver Sports Presentation for the 2014 Commonwealth Games in Glasgow.

The agreement, signed yesterday, includes in-stadia presentations andentertainment as well as information services.

The entertainment group will also coordinate and stage the medal ceremonies for the games.

GBE worked the same role at every Commonwealth Games since 2002 in Manchester, England.

"GBE have unparalleled experience in delivering Sport Presentation within a Commonwealth Games environment, which is matched with their reputation amongst International Sport Federations for the successful delivery of services at both single-sport events and multi-sport Games," said Greg Warnecke, Glasgow 2014 Head of Sport.

"Importantly, GBE have been able to demonstrate a great understanding of all 17 Glasgow 2014 sports which will ensure that Glasgow 2014 will be able to deliver an outstanding Sport Presentation experience for everyone within each competition venue."
